Lumibird S.A. (LBIRD.PA) Stock Analysis & Winston Score
Lumibird is a French company that makes lasers — devices that produce very precise, powerful beams of light. It sells these lasers to customers in two main areas: the medical field (eye surgery equipment and diagnostic tools) and defense and industrial markets (range finders, sensors, and scientific instruments). Lumibird is one of Europe's largest laser manufacturers and owns well-known brands like Quantel. The company earns money by selling laser hardware and related equipment, with some recurring revenue from service contracts and spare parts. It operates mainly in Europe, North America, and Asia, generating roughly €200 million in annual revenue. Its competitive edge comes from deep technical expertise and proprietary laser technology that is difficult for newcomers to replicate. The key growth driver is rising demand for medical lasers, particularly in ophthalmology, but the main risk is its relatively small scale, which makes it vulnerable to larger competitors and supply chain disruptions in specialized optical components.
